Understanding what is personalized cancer medicine: Tailored Treatments for Enhanced Outcomes
What is personalized cancer medicine relates to tailoring medical treatments directly to the genetic details of each patient.
Through analyzing a patient's genetic information, doctors can determine which treatments are most likely to be effective, minimizing the Extra resources risk of side effects and increasing the probability of successful outcomes.
This methodology is changing the field of oncology, offering treatments that are as distinct as the patients themselves.
Customized medicine not only improves treatment efficacy but also improves patient quality of life by avoiding unnecessary or ineffective treatments.
